Attwood, Philip. "What is a medal?" Medal (2012): 6-9.

Abstract: There are two known types of medals--those given to award acts of
valor and those awarded in competition. However, these are offshoots of an
older tradition. Commemorative medals often celebrated individuals and
events. This dates from early 15th-century Italy. A brief history is
provided, with a look at the development of medal tradition and forms.
